Output d17e68f2e5fb8032ee817ecada6a802008395bacddd101d4e802e046d36312df:0

value
3311200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aabd543c3ad90e5d9593994d5fa8ddd81ce4be8 OP_EQUAL
address
3HFSeKqbQnJ23kmAskPKxoba2iBrJdgRA2
transaction
d17e68f2e5fb8032ee817ecada6a802008395bacddd101d4e802e046d36312df
confirmations
153705
spent
true